Erosion-Resistant Galvanized Gabion Baskets for River and Embankment Stabilization

River and embankment erosion is a significant challenge faced by many communities and industries. The constant flow of water and the natural forces of nature can cause significant damage to these structures, leading to costly repairs and potential safety hazards. One effective solution to this problem is the use of erosion-resistant galvanized gabion baskets for river and embankment stabilization.
Gabion baskets are wire mesh containers that are filled with rocks or other materials to create a strong, stable structure. These baskets are then used to reinforce and stabilize riverbanks and embankments, preventing erosion and providing a long-lasting solution to this problem.
One of the key benefits of using galvanized gabion baskets is their resistance to corrosion. Galvanization is a process that involves coating the metal with a layer of zinc, which provides a protective barrier against rust and other forms of corrosion. This makes the gabion baskets ideal for use in wet environments, such as along rivers and embankments, where they are exposed to water and other corrosive elements.
In addition to their corrosion resistance, galvanized gabion baskets also offer excellent flexibility and adaptability. The wire mesh used to construct the baskets is flexible, allowing it to conform to the shape of the riverbank or embankment it is being used to stabilize. This means that the baskets can be easily customized to fit the specific needs of each project, providing a tailored solution to erosion problems.
